    You just created a new web site but want to pass on the search engine rankings of the old one to the new one. What is the most effective and spider/visitor friendly strategy to implement your web site redirection? You should use a 301 redirect.

    What is a 301 redirect?

    It is used when you want to redirect your web site or web pages. The code "301" is interpreted as "moved permanently". After the code, the URL of the missing or renamed page is noted, followed by a space, then followed by the new location or file name.

    Requirements for using a 301 redirect

    Apache server.
    Most hosting services used these days have Apache servers. Check with your host if you are not sure.

    .htaccess file

    a search engine spider requests a web page, your web server will check for an .htaccess file. The .htaccess file contains specific directions that are processed then sent back to the browser.

    How do I implement a 301 redirect?

    1. Create an .htaccess file - you can use Notepad to create the file. Remember to insert a period at the beginning of the file name with no extension at the end (ie .htaccess).

    2. Create a line of code that reads like this:

    Redirect permanent / http://www.domainname.com/

    The first "/" indicates that everything from the top level of the site down should be redirected.

    All current links within the search engine results from the old site will redirect to the top level of your new site.
